MySql数据库的查询、删除、增加、修改语句?
介绍mysql数据库的基本查询、删除、增加、修改语句等常用数据库语句。
第一步,查询语句:
select* from table_name;
或
select * from table_name where [条件]
第二步,增加语句或插入数据
insert into table_name (clus…) values(values…)
实例如图:
第三步,修改数据:update tablename set xx=xx,xxx=xx where xxx=xxx and xxx=xxx;
第四步, 删除语句
delete table_name where 条件
实例如图:
注意事项注意没行末尾的分号不能漏掉!查询时注意*好不能乱用,否则会导致数据库运行负担。最好是需要什么字段就查询什么字段。
数据库SQL如何删除数据,delete语句的使用方法?
数据库SQL如何删除数据,delete语句的使用方法。
1、创建一个临时表,用于演示sqlserver语法中delete删除的使用方法IF OBJECT_ID(‘tempdb..#tblDelete’) IS NOT NULL DROP TABLE #tblDelete; CREATE TABLE #tblDelete(Code varchar(50), Total int);
2、往临时表#tblDelete中插入几行测试,用于演示如何删除数据insert into #tblDelete(Code, Total) values(‘Code1’, 30);insert into #tblDelete(Code, Total) values(‘Code2’, 40);insert into #tblDelete(Code, Total) values(‘Code3’, 50);insert into #tblDelete(Code, Total) values(‘Code4’, 6);
3、查询临时表#tblDelete中的测试数据select * from #tblDelete;
4、删除临时表#tblDelete中Code栏位=Code3的记录,使用下面的delete语句delete #tblDelete where Code = ‘Code3’
5、再次查询临时表#tblDelete的结果,可以看到Code3的记录没有了select * from #tblDelete;
6、删除临时表#tblDelete中Code栏位=Code2的记录,使用下面的delete语句。注意,下面的delete语句后面有一个from关键字,这个关键字是可以省略的,但是建议不要省略delete from #tblDelete where Code = ‘Code2’
7、再次查询临时表#tblDelete的结果,可以看到Code2的记录没有了select * from #tblDelete;
8、最后,如果想要快速的删除表中的所有数据,有下面两种方式。第二种方式速度更快delete from #tblDelete;truncate table #tblDelete;
我想根据id批量删除几条记录,该怎么写sql语句,我用的数据库是mysql!
- 前台传过来的是这样的!然后我用的sql语句是这样的!但是这种语句只适合id全掸触侧吠乇杜岔森唱缉部是数字的,我的id里面有字母怎么办,我该怎么批量删除(注:我不想去逗号循环多次调用delete方法!)
- 用or就行了吧, ID =值1 or ID=值2 。。。。。。
mysql数据库A表中B字段有数据库,求删除带baidu的数据语句
- mysql数据库A表中B字段有数据库,求删除带baidu的数据语句注:这3个都在一个框里面,而不是3条数据原数据搜狐$www.sohu.com/1.rar$1.5M百度$www.baidu.com/1.rar$1.3M新浪$www.sina.com/1.rar$5.6M删除后数据搜狐$http://www.sohu.com/1.rar$1.5M新浪$www.sina.com/1.rar$5.6M
- 只能用 update变为空吧
mysql 删除列的语句哪个是正确的?
- A: 酣抚丰幌莶呵奉童斧阔 删除列:alter table 表名 drop column 列名B: 删除列:alter table 表名 drop 列名两个都能用吗?
- alter table 表名 drop column 列名
mysql数据库sql语句删除语句的使用
- 如图中所建的表,怎么删去p1,p2逆反(11,12的逆反是12,11)的记录,最后剩下id=1,p1=11,p2=12的元素。
- 这么牛啊 我也想知道 关注一下
mysql语句:如何删除表中只有一个字的这条记录。
- 表名:products字段名:b_name要删除 b_name中,凡是只有一个中文名字的这条记录。例如:b_name记录的数据有 王小二,李,李三,四小。 现在要删除的是“李”,因为他只有一个字。
- delete from products as p where LENGTH(p.b_name)=1;len()datalen()LENGTH()
mysql语句怎么做这个表的条件查询删除操作?
- 请问怎么查询删除学号在2001-2099之间,数学和化学不及格的学生的所有数据(只要这两门不及格学生的所有学科成绩和信息就从这张表删除)?
- 您好,你的问题,我之前好像也遇到过,以下是我原来的解决思路和方法,希望能帮助到你,若有错误,还望见谅!使用truncate语句就可以删除表中所有数据。truncate 语句的简单说明:一般情况下,删除数据大家都在使用delete语句;这个 truncate 命令很简单,它的意思是:删除表的所有记录;相当于 delete 语句不写 where 子句一样;其语法结构为:TRUNCATE [TABLE] tbl_name;这里简单的给出个示例,我想删除 friends 表中所有的记录,可以使用如下语句:truncate table friends;如果想要删除表的所有数据,truncate语句要比 delete 语句快。因为 truncate 删除了表,然后根据表结构重新建立它,而 delete 删除的是记录,并没有尝试去修改表;不过truncate命令快规快,却不像delete命令那样对事务处理是安全的。因此,如果我们想要执行truncate删除的表正在进行事务处理,这个命令就会产生退出并产生错误信息。非常感谢您的耐心观看,如有帮助请采纳,祝生活愉快!谢谢!
mysql 删除语句的问题
- delete from t_yimutian_price a where not exists(select 1 from(select MIN(id) id from t_yimutian_price group by name,price,low_price,high_price,avg_price,unit,DATE_FORMA发孩篡绞诂悸磋溪单娄T(create_time,%Y-%m_%d),location,province) b) where a.id=b.id 请问这句语句有什么错误?[Err] 1064 – You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near a where not exists(select 1 from(select MIN(id) id from t_yimutian_price group at line 1
- 第一行末尾那个where去掉?
mysql 删除语句的问题求指导!
- delete from t_yimu涪氦帝教郜寄佃犀顶篓tian_price a where id not in(select MIN(id) bid from t_yimutian_price group by name,price,low_price,high_price,avg_price,unit,DATE_FORMAT(create_time,%Y-%m_%d),location,province)我这个语句执行不了?求指导[Err] 1064 – You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near a where id not in(select MIN(id) bid from t_yimutian_price group by name,pri at line 1
- mysql复合语句不支持操作同一个表
mysql语句 模糊匹配删除或替换怎么写
- 表db_centent字段body“怎样才能把大象装冰箱”模糊匹配“才能” 删除“才能”模糊匹配“才能” 替换成“可以”我只懂简单增删改查语句 百度那些案例才复杂不是想要的来个简洁明了的sql命令
- 你好的!update `db_centent` set `body`=replace(`body`,才能,可以);您试试要是不对欢迎追问!